(S)-N-Boc-2-Hydroxymethylmorpholine CAS#: 135065-76-8; ChemWhat Code: 17287
Names & Identifiers |
| Product Name | (S)-N-Boc-2-Hydroxymethylmorpholine |
| Synonyms | (S)-2-Hydroxymethylmorpholine-4-carboxylic acid tert-butyl ester;N-Boc-(S)-3-morpholine-methanol;(S)-N-BOC-2-HYDROXYMETHYLMORPHOLINE;(S)-4-BOC-2-HYDROXYMETHYL-MORPHOLINE;(2S)-2-hydroxymethyl-morpholine-4-carboxylic acid tert-butyl ester;(S)-N-Boc-2-HydroxyMethyl…;tert-Butyl (2S)-2-(hydroxyMethyl)Morpholine-4-carboxylate;4-Morpholinecarboxylic acid, 2-(hydroxyMethyl)-, 1,1-diMethylethyl ester, (2S)- |
| CAS Registry Number | 135065-76-8 |
| Molecular Formula | C10H19NO4 |
| Molecular Weight | 217.26 |

Chemical & Physical Properties |
| Melting point | 60-62 °C |
| Boiling Point | 321 °C |
| Density | 1.118 |
| Flash Point | 148 °C |
| Water Solubility | Slightly soluble in water. |
| Sensitive | Light Sensitive |
